Web-interfaces without using the mouse wheel

Do you find touch interfaces convenient? I think you think. After all, it is really convenient to communicate with the interface on “you”. Why do we need a mediator in our communication? Why complicate things?

The other day, the thought crept into my head that it would be nice to try to implement something similar on an ordinary web page. Let not the touch, due to the fact that you still have to manipulate the cursor with the mouse, but some simplification, giving the user the opportunity to go a step closer to the interface with which he interacts.

The essence of the simplification is that the user, being on the page of the site, can hold down the left mouse button and move the page to the desired height. In my opinion, less energy is spent on a click and a slight movement of a brush than on a wheel's torsion. Imagine what you need to do in order to twist the wheel: lift your finger, move it to the right, twist the wheel and put your finger back into place (in most cases). You already see how much micro movements need to be done for such a simple task. And how many times a day do you have to make such movements? I propose a simpler option - just two movements: click and drag the mouse. Such movements are easier and do not distract from the main thing - from the information for which we come. And this crackle when scrolling, especially in cheap mice, do you hear? For example, it distracts me. Try, compare two variants of page flip, mine and traditional. I think you will notice the difference.
